Chicken, Broccoli & Mushroom Stir-Fry

Ingredients

Scale
  • 500g diced chicken breast
  • 2 cups broccoli florets
  • 2 cups sliced mushrooms
  • 1 small chopped onion
  • 2 minced garlic cloves
  • 2 tbsp soy sauce
  • 1 tbsp sesame oil
  • 1 tbsp olive oil
  • 1 cup jasmine or basmati rice
  • 2 cups water
  • Pinch of salt
  • 1 tsp cornstarch + 2 tbsp water (for slurry)
  • Salt & pepper to taste
  • Chili flakes (optional)

Instructions

  1. Cook rice: In a pot, boil 2 cups water, add rice and salt, then simmer for 15 minutes until fluffy.
  2. Prepare chicken: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ium-high heat. Sauté the chicken with salt and pepper until cooked through (5-7 minutes). Remove from pan.
  3. Sauté vegetables: Add sesame oil to the same skillet; cook onion and garlic until fragrant. Then add broccoli and mushrooms, stir-frying until tender-crisp.
  4. Combine: Return chicken to the skillet, add soy sauce and stir well. Mix in a cornstarch slurry (1 tsp cornstarch + 2 tbsp water) to thicken the sauce.
  5. Serve hot over rice.
